How To Fix ISLM_API341 - Errors occurred when trying to determine the status for table function &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: ISLM_API - API Messages

  • Message number: 341

  • Message text: Errors occurred when trying to determine the status for table function &1

    The SAP error message ISLM_API341 indicates that there was an issue when trying to determine the status for a table function in the SAP system. This error can occur for various reasons, and understanding the cause and potential solutions can help in resolving the issue.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Table Function Not Found: The specified table function (&1) may not exist in the system or may have been deleted.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user executing the function may not have the necessary authorizations to access the table function.
    3. System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ues in the system that prevent the proper execution of the table function.
    4. Database Issues: There could be underlying database issues, such as connectivity problems or corruption in the database.
    5. Transport Issues: If the table function was recently transported from another system, there may have been issues during the transport process.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Table Function Existence: Verify that the table function specified in the error message actually exists in the system. You can do this by checking in the relevant transaction (e.g., SE11 for Data Dictionary).

    2. Review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to execute the table function. You can check this using transaction SU53 to analyze authorization failures.

    3. Check System Configuration: Review the configuration settings related to the table function. Ensure that all necessary settings are correctly configured.

    4. Database Health Check: Perform a health check on the database to ensure that it is functioning correctly. This may involve checking for connectivity issues or running database consistency checks.

    5. Review Transport Logs: If the table function was recently transported, check the transport logs for any errors or warnings that may indicate issues during the transport process.

    6. Debugging: If the issue persists, consider debugging the function to identify where the error is occurring. This may require technical expertise in ABAP programming.

    7. Consult S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address this specific error message or provide additional troubleshooting steps.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: SE11 (Data Dictionary), SE37 (Function Module), SU53 (Authorization Check), ST22 (Dump Analysis).
